Motorola is gearing up to expand its Edge 40 series with the introduction of a ‘Neo’ model.
Following the success of the Moto Edge 40, which launched in India in May and later saw the release of a ‘Viva Magenta’ colour variant in June, the Edge 40 Neo is poised to be a more affordable option.
A recent listing on Geekbench has revealed some tantalising details about the forthcoming smartphone.
The phone’s listing on Geekbench, spotted by 91mobiles, offers an intriguing insight into what the Motorola Edge 40 Neo may bring to the table.
With a single core score of 3,559 and a multi-core score of 8,508, the phone’s performance is eagerly awaited.
Though the specific chipset was not detailed, the listing showed an octa-core processor with a peak clock speed of 2.50GHz, accompanied by the Mali-G610 MC3 GPU.
There are high chances of this being a MediaTek Dimensity 1050 SoC.
The Geekbench listing also revealed that the Moto Edge 40 Neo could come with 8GB of RAM, coupled with Android 13, the latest operating system.
This combination suggests that the device could be primed for multitasking and smooth functionality.
The appearance of the Moto Edge 40 Neo on the UAE’s Telecommunications and Digital Government Regulatory Authority (TDRA) website and previous leaks provide a glimpse into its expected launch timeline and pricing.
The smartphone may launch on September 15th at an anticipated price of €399 (about Rs 36,000).
Motorola’s Edge 40 Neo is expected to feature a 6.55-inch Full HD+ pOLED display with a 144Hz refresh rate.
Additionally, the mention of a ‘Black Beauty Shade’ colour is one of the options that will be available.
There is also the potential inclusion of the MediaTek Dimensity 1050 SoC, as mentioned above.
The Moto Edge 40 Neo is rumoured to be launched with up to 12GB of RAM and 256GB of onboard storage, offering ample space and speed for demanding users.
Its camera setup, expected to sport a dual-camera arrangement with 50MP and 13MP sensors, along with a 32MP front camera.
The device could house a substantial 5,000mAh battery although charging speeds are not known. An IP68 rating, if confirmed, would signify resistance to dust and water, adding a layer of durability to the device.
